The Beauty of Impression

Letterpress is a centuries-old printing method that uses pressure to press ink into soft cotton paper — creating a tactile, debossed finish that feels as good as it looks. It adds depth, weight, and authenticity to any piece. Every impression is a physical mark of quality, intention, and care — subtle to the eye, unforgettable to the touch.

How It's Made

We use lovingly restored Heidelberg Windmill presses — precision machines that combine industrial heritage with flawless execution. Every sheet is hand-fed. Every run is calibrated by eye. Our inks are mixed by hand, and we often combine traditional letterpress with foil stamping, blind debossing, or die-cutting for fully custom results.

The Papers We Use

We print on cotton, bamboo, and textured stocks from some of the world’s finest mills. Heavyweight boards and soft, pillowy papers absorb the impression beautifully. We can duplex, edge-paint, emboss, or custom cut to your spec.

A Heritage Craft — Reimagined

Letterpress once powered newspapers and books — now it's a creative choice. What used to be purely functional has become an art form.
